Thomas Gifford COLLETT

COLLETT, Thomas Gifford

Service Number: SX11960
Enlisted: 26 March 1941
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 2nd/3rd Machine Gun Battalion
Born: Strathalbyn, South Australia, 12 November 1919
Home Town: Strathalbyn, Alexandrina, South Australia
Schooling: Not yet discovered
Occupation: Not yet discovered
Died: Strathalbyn, South Australia, 7 July 2001, aged 81 years, cause of death not yet discovered
Cemetery: Strathalbyn Cemetery, S.A.

World War 2 Service

26 Mar 1941: Involvement Private, SX11960
26 Mar 1941: Enlisted Wayville, SA
26 Mar 1941: Enlisted Australian Military Forces (WW2) , Private, SX11960
16 Feb 1942: Involvement 2nd/3rd Machine Gun Battalion, Prisoners of War
22 May 1946: Discharged
22 May 1946: Discharged Australian Military Forces (WW2) , Private, SX11960
